What is viral marketing? Viral marketing is a marketing strategy that uses the power of viral sharing to spread a message or product. It’s based on the principle that if enough people share something, it will reach a wide audience and possibly become popular. How does viral marketing work? The basic idea is to create something that’s interesting and useful, and then make it available online. You can use various methods to promote your content, including social media, email campaigns, and even paid advertising. Why is viral marketing so effective? Viral marketing works because it taps into our natural tendency to pass on information. We’re fascinated by things that are new and different, and we want to share them with our friends. This process can quickly spread your message across the internet, reaching a vast audience of potential customers.
